While she's on her mission I made a little "checklist" of things I need from her while she's on her mission. The only way to get it all done is with a little organization I told her hahaha. For each month, I'm going to make a calendar with pictures or what she did each day. I printed her out a little spreadsheet with each day of the month where she can write a few words or put a picture for that day. Then at the end of the month she will mail it back to me and I'll scrap it. I got the inspiration from Heidi Swapp.
